What is Nar-Anon?
Are you sick and tired of being sick and tired? Have you tried everything you can think of to change the addict and nothing seems to work? Don’t give up. There is hope. If you would like your life to be different, Nar-Anon can offer you a better way to live…you are no longer alone.
Mission Statement: The Nar-Anon Family Groups are a worldwide fellowship for those affected by someone else’s addiction. As a twelve-step program, we offer our help by sharing our experience, strength, and hope.
Why do I need help due to someone else’s addiction?
We who care the most suffer from the addict’s erratic behavior. Soon, we begin to think we are to blame and assume the guilt, fears, and responsibilities of the addict. Thus, we become sick, too. The obsession of the family becomes apparent when we try to control the addict’s using. We become obsessed with where they are, what they are doing, and how we might control their addiction. We become victims of denial.
What will I find at Nar-Anon?
You will find love, understanding, and hope in the Nar-Anon Family Group … we find others with the same feelings and problems.
Is my changed attitude going to make a difference?
Most of us believe the addict is the one who needs to change. It comes as a shock to hear we also need to change. By working the steps … we begin … to change ourselves.
What can I expect if I keep going to meetings?
You will learn how to change your own thinking and attitude about the addict – about life. This is your program and your recovery. If you keep coming back … if you work it … it will work.
